Methansulfonic acid/di-phosphorus pentoxide (4:1) was found to be an efficient reagent for one-pot synthesis of acylaryl methane sulfonates of phenolic esters via Friesrearrangement. This method is easy, rapid, and high-yielding reactions for the synthesis of acylaryl methane sulfonates.

Methanesulfonicacid/phosphorus oxychloride (MAPO) was found to be a new effecient reagent in the Fries rearrangement of phenolic esters. Fries rearrangement of phenolic esters in the presence of MAPO, gave acylaryl methane sulfonates as major products.
